IntelliJ Git Интеграция - Git - выход пустой версии

В настоящее время я пытаюсь использовать интеграцию Git для IntelliJ 2016.2, но всякий раз, когда я указываю ее на исполняемый файл, я получаю следующую проблему:

Git Проблема с выпуском версии

Это не позволяет технически предотвратить интеграцию от работы, но вызывает проблемы с обновлением индекса и т.д.

Я запускаю Windows 7 с полностью новой установкой, но у меня была такая же проблема на предыдущем ПК (это рабочие машины с различными раздражающими уровнями безопасности), но у меня есть коллеги с тем же набором, у которых нет таких вопросы.

ИЗМЕНИТЬ

Я должен был упомянуть, что он отлично работает в командной строке:

Git Выход командной строки

Я уверен, что я кое-что прочитал о том, как это происходит внутри, что означает, что при вызове внешним исполняемым файлом результат становится зависающим, но я не могу найти ссылку снова.

Ответ 1

Убедитесь, что вы установили правильный путь к исполняемому файлу Git: IntelliJ > Настройки > Контроль версий > Git должен быть C:/.../ Git/ bin/git.exe

Не устанавливайте git - bash.exe или git -cmd.exe

Ответ 2

Случилось со мной точно так же.

Git работает из командной строки, но путь:

C:\Program Files\Git\bin\git.exe

и путь (как здесь говорят):

C:\Program Files\Git\cmd\git.exe

(это путь, который я получил, когда я сделал, where git.exe в cmd)

не работал

Поэтому я пошел в git-bash и сделал where git.exe, where git.exe, и я получил другой путь, который работает.

enter image description here

Надеюсь, поможет

Ответ 3

сначала получите ваш путь к git.exe с помощью команды. введите это в терминале cmd

git --info-path

затем найдите местоположение your_directory\Git\bin\git.exe мой был C:\Users\saigopi\AppData\Local\Programs\Git\bin

добавить этот путь в Android Studio

File-> Настройки-> Контроль версий → Git

добавьте свой путь в Путь к исполняемому файлу Git и протестируйте его

Ответ 4

У меня была такая же проблема, и я пробовал несколько вещей. Впоследствии он снова начал работать, когда я понизил мою установку git.